2019 CommRadio NFL Draft Show: Episode 4

Video posted April 19, 2019 in CommRadio, Sports by CommRadio, Sports by NFL Draft Staff

On this episode of the CommRadio NFL Draft Show we talk about the SEC conference and break down AFC and NFC East team needs.
